Google
×
Achille Souchard

Achille Souchard

French cyclist
Alphonse Achille Souchard was a French cyclist who competed in the road race at the 1920 Summer Olympics. He finished tenth individually and won a gold medal in the team time trial. Wikipedia
Born: May 17, 1900, Le Mans, France
Died: September 20, 1976 (age 76 years), Paris, France